Advertisement

ARM CoreSight SoC-400 R3P1 技术参考手册

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
《ARM CoreSight SoC-400 R3P1技术参考手册》提供了关于ARM处理器监控与调试子系统CoreSight的具体配置和使用方法,是深入了解SoC-400组件的权威指南。 ARM CoreSight SOC-400 R3P1技术参考手册提供了关于该硬件组件的详细信息和技术规范。文档涵盖了CoreSight系统架构、调试接口以及如何利用这些功能进行软件开发和调试的相关内容。对于从事嵌入式系统设计与开发的专业人士来说,这份手册是一份宝贵的资源。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ARM CoreSight SoC-400 R3P1
    优质
    《ARM CoreSight SoC-400 R3P1技术参考手册》提供了关于ARM处理器监控与调试子系统CoreSight的具体配置和使用方法,是深入了解SoC-400组件的权威指南。 ARM CoreSight SOC-400 R3P1技术参考手册提供了关于该硬件组件的详细信息和技术规范。文档涵盖了CoreSight系统架构、调试接口以及如何利用这些功能进行软件开发和调试的相关内容。对于从事嵌入式系统设计与开发的专业人士来说,这份手册是一份宝贵的资源。
  • Zynq-7000 SoC
    优质
    《Zynq-7000 SoC技术参考手册》详尽介绍了Zynq-7000全可编程SoC架构,涵盖硬件与软件配置、设计流程及应用案例,是开发者探索这一高性能系统级芯片的理想指南。 Zynq-7000 SoC 技术参考手册提供了该系列片上系统的设计详情和技术规范。文档详细介绍了硬件架构、接口标准以及开发工具的使用方法,是进行相关项目设计的重要参考资料。
  • UG585(Zynq-7000 SOC
    优质
    《UG585 Zynq-7000 SOCs技术参考手册》详尽介绍了Xilinx Zynq-7000系列片上系统的硬件架构、资源及配置,是开发人员的重要参考资料。 Zynq-7000 SoC 技术参考手册提供了详细的信息和技术指导,帮助开发者理解和利用该系列器件的强大功能。这份文档涵盖了从硬件架构到软件开发的各个方面,是进行相关项目设计的重要资源。
  • ARM Cortex-A9
    优质
    《ARM Cortex-A9技术参考手册》详尽介绍了Cortex-A9处理器的核心架构、工作原理及编程接口等关键信息,是开发者深入了解并高效运用该处理器的理想资源。 《ARM Cortex-A9技术参考手册》提供了关于Cortex-A9处理器架构的详细信息和技术规格,是开发者了解该处理器特性和功能的重要资源。此文档涵盖了包括体系结构、寄存器描述以及编程模型在内的多个方面,旨在帮助工程师更有效地利用Cortex-A9进行系统设计和软件开发。
  • ARM Cortex-M33核心
    优质
    《ARM Cortex-M33核心技术参考手册》详细解析了Cortex-M33处理器架构,涵盖其设计原理、功能特性及应用开发指南,是深入理解该系列微控制器内核的理想资料。 ARM Cortex-M33内核是高性能且低功耗的处理器核心,专为满足嵌入式系统中的实时需求而设计。它是Cortex-M系列的一部分,并提供了丰富的指令集、系统控制能力和多种调试选项,广泛应用于智能传感器、微控制器单元(MCU)和可穿戴设备等众多领域。 ARM Cortex-M33内核支持最新的ARMv8-M架构功能,包括安全扩展,这使它能够执行加密算法并提供安全存储。因此,该核心适合用于物联网(IoT)设备及网络设备等领域,在这些应用中安全性至关重要。此外,Cortex-M33内核集成了ARM TrustZone技术,为系统提供了两个独立的运行环境:一个用于执行敏感操作的安全环境和另一个用于常规任务的非安全环境。这两个环境之间有严格的隔离机制来防止恶意软件或攻击对系统的威胁。 该核心还具有高效的数字信号处理(DSP)能力,能够快速完成复杂的数学运算。这对于需要高效进行浮点数计算的应用程序(例如音频处理、运动控制及传感器数据处理)非常有用。 在设计方面,ARM Cortex-M33内核采用了三级流水线来实现更高效和更快的指令执行速度。此外,该核心支持可选的浮点单元(FPU),为单精度浮点运算提供了硬件支持,并大大加快了这类计算的速度。 Cortex-M33还具备丰富的调试特性以满足系统设计与软件开发的需求。它提供的多种调试模式包括基本串行调试和JTAG接口等工具,帮助开发者高效地解决在软件开发过程中遇到的问题。 内核的电源管理功能也是一个亮点,提供了睡眠、深度睡眠及待机等多种低功耗模式来优化能量使用效率,在依赖电池供电的应用中尤为重要。 ARM Cortex-M33核心还拥有强大的中断处理能力。它可以迅速响应并处理外部和内部事件,并支持多达15个不同优先级级别的中断以及嵌套功能。这确保了即使在高负载情况下,系统也能保持快速且准确的事件管理。 此外,在与外设连接方面,Cortex-M33核心兼容多种接口如GPIO、UART、I2C及SPI等,并能灵活配置以适应不同的设计需求。它还支持多层次存储架构来高效访问内部和外部内存资源并优化使用效率,从而进一步提高性能水平。 ARM Cortex-M33技术参考手册是为系统设计师、集成商以及软件开发者提供的宝贵资料,涵盖了该核心的技术规格、编程模型、接口信息及调试与优化技巧等内容。这份文档提供了实现高性能且低能耗的嵌入式系统的全部必要知识。
  • Zynq-7000 SoC (版本 1.12.2)- UG585
    优质
    本技术参考手册是针对Xilinx Zynq-7000 All Programmable SoC设计的重要指南,详述了器件架构、接口及IP配置等信息,适用于开发者进行高效开发和调试。 Zynq的最新官方技术参考手册包含了我的相关注释说明。
  • ARM Cortex-M系列汇总
    优质
    《ARM Cortex-M系列技术参考手册汇总》是一本全面介绍ARM公司Cortex-M系列微控制器架构与特性的技术书籍,适合嵌入式系统开发人员阅读和参考。 Cortex-M0 Cortex-M0p Cortex-M1 Cortex-M3 Cortex-M4 Cortex-M7 Cortex-M23 Cortex-M33 Cortex-M55 Cortex-M85
  • ESP8266
    优质
    《ESP8266技术手册参考》是一份详尽的技术文档,涵盖ESP8266 Wi-Fi模块的所有功能和使用方法,为开发者提供全面的编程指南与应用案例。 没有0分的选项,选择了1分下载。这里提供一份ESP8266的技术参考手册(英文版),官网也有该文档。如果你懒得去官网下载或找不到的话,可以在这里下载:esp8266-technical_reference_en.pdf。
  • Node.js
    优质
    《Node.js技术手册参考》是一本全面介绍Node.js开发的技术书籍,涵盖了从基础到高级的各种应用场景和最佳实践。 Node.js是一个基于Google Chrome V8引擎的JavaScript运行环境,用于在服务端上执行JavaScript代码。它采用事件驱动、非阻塞IO模型的设计理念,使得开发人员可以使用与前端交互性强的JavaScript进行后端编程,实现了前后端语言的一致性,并简化了全栈开发流程。 **Node.js是什么?** Node.js不是一个新的编程语言,而是一个运行时环境,允许开发者在服务器上编写和执行JavaScript代码。通过这种方式,它将前端技术的优势带到了服务端领域,提高了应用的响应速度和可扩展性。 **概念** - **事件驱动**: Node.js的核心是事件循环机制,利用回调函数处理非阻塞IO操作。 - **非阻塞IO**: 与传统的阻塞式I/O模型不同,在Node.js中等待一个IO操作完成时不会冻结其他任务的执行,而是继续处理其他事件,从而提高了系统的效率和并发能力。 - **V8引擎**:这是Google开发的一个高性能JavaScript虚拟机,被广泛应用于各种场景下。 **特性** - **性能优越**: V8即时编译技术使得Node.js能够快速地运行JavaScript代码。 - **单线程设计**: 尽管是单线程模型,但通过事件循环和异步处理机制实现了高并发的能力。 - **模块化生态系统**: Node.js拥有庞大的npm(Node包管理器)库,为开发者提供了丰富的可复用组件。 **使用场景** - 实时应用:如聊天室、协作工具等需要实时交互的应用; - API服务器: 用于构建RESTful APIs以支持移动或Web应用程序的数据需求。 - 流媒体服务: 处理大型文件传输和视频流的实时传递。 - 构建工具: 如Gulp, Webpack等自动化构建流程。 **不适用场景** Node.js并不适合处理CPU密集型任务或是需要多线程并行计算的应用。对于不太熟悉JavaScript语言的团队来说,学习曲线可能较为陡峭。 **常用技术点与命令** - `npm`: Node.js包管理器,用于安装、发布和维护项目依赖。 - `node` 命令: 启动Node.js REPL或执行脚本段落件。 - `package.json`: 记录项目的元数据及依赖信息的配置文件。 **常用模块** 包括但不限于: - express:一个轻量级Web应用框架,用于快速构建web服务器; - socket.io:实现实时双向通信的功能库; - axios: HTTP客户端库,简化网络请求处理流程。 - mongoose: MongoDB对象模型(ODM)工具,便于数据库操作。 **异步编程范式** Node.js的核心之一就是其对异步编程的支持。开发者可以使用回调函数、Promise或async/await等机制来编写非阻塞代码,这有助于提高应用的并发性能并避免长时间等待IO操作导致程序停滞不前的问题。 通过这些特点和技术点,Node.js为构建高效且可扩展的服务端解决方案提供了新的可能性。
  • ESP8266.pdf
    优质
    《ESP8266技术参考手册》是一份详尽的技术文档,为开发者提供了关于ESP8266 Wi-Fi模块的所有必要信息和指导,包括硬件规格、软件API及应用案例。 本段落介绍了ESP8266的各种接口及其相关细节,包括功能、参数配置、函数说明以及应用示例等内容。手册结构涵盖了发布说明、概述、GPIO介绍、SDIO通信SPI兼容模式及SPI模块使用指南等部分。其中,“概述”对ESP8266各接口进行了简要描述;“GPIO”详细介绍了其功能、寄存器和参数配置情况;“SDIO通信SPI兼容模式”则深入探讨了该模式的功能,并提供了DEMO实现方案以及针对ESP8266端与STM32端的软件说明。最后,“SPI模块使用说明”部分详尽地讲解了如何使用SPI模块。